Porosity and Hygiene: A Breeding Ground for Bacteria

One of the most significant disadvantages of wooden utensils stems from their porous nature. Unlike non-porous materials such as stainless steel or silicone, wood has tiny pores that can absorb liquids and food particles, creating a potential breeding ground for bacteria. This is particularly concerning when handling raw meat, as juices can seep into the wood and potentially cause cross-contamination. While some studies suggest certain hardwoods have antimicrobial properties, this benefit is negated if the utensil is not dried completely, allowing trapped moisture to foster bacterial growth. Cracks and splinters that develop over time also provide ideal hiding spots for germs that are difficult to clean thoroughly.

High-Maintenance Cleaning and Care

Wooden utensils require diligent, hands-on maintenance, a stark contrast to the convenience of tossing other tools into the dishwasher. Exposure to the high temperatures and extended moisture cycles of a dishwasher can cause the wood to warp, crack, and become brittle. As a result, they must be hand-washed with mild soap and warm water, and then immediately dried with a towel. Furthermore, to prevent the wood from drying out and cracking, it needs to be regularly conditioned with food-grade mineral oil or beeswax. This routine oiling adds another step to your cleaning process that other utensil materials don't require.

Challenges with Staining and Odor Absorption

The porous quality that affects hygiene also makes wooden utensils highly susceptible to absorbing colors and odors from food. Ingredients with strong pigments, like tomato sauce, beets, or turmeric, can leave stubborn stains on the surface of spoons and cutting boards. More frustratingly, strong smells from garlic, onions, or spices can be absorbed into the wood and linger, potentially transferring unwanted flavors to future dishes. While techniques like rubbing with lemon and salt can help, they don't always fully resolve the issue, and some home cooks resort to dedicating specific utensils for certain types of food to avoid this flavor transfer.

Wear and Tear Over Time

Over prolonged use, wooden utensils are more prone to wear and tear than their metal or silicone counterparts. Constant exposure to fluctuating heat and moisture can degrade the wood fibers, leading to a rough, frayed surface. When deep cracks or splinters form, the utensil is no longer sanitary and should be replaced to prevent food and bacteria from getting trapped. In contrast, a high-quality stainless steel or silicone utensil can last for decades with minimal degradation.
